Class Target
- Пространство имен
- easyar
- Сборка
- EasyAR.Sense.dll
Target - это базовый класс в EasyAR для всех целей, которые могут отслеживаться `ImageTracker`_ или другими алгоритмами.
public class Target : RefBase, IDisposable
- Наследование
-
Target
- Реализация
- Derived
- Наследуемые члены
Методы
Clone()
public Target Clone()
CloneObject()
protected override object CloneObject()
meta()
Получает метаданные, установленные setMetaData. Или в цели, возвращенной облачным распознаванием, получает метаданные, установленные сервером.
public virtual string meta()
name()
Получает имя цели. Имя используется для различения целей в JSON-файле.
public virtual string name()
runtimeID()
Получает ID цели. ID цели - это целочисленные данные, создаваемые во время выполнения; они действительны (не нулевые) только после успешной конфигурации. Этот ID не равен нулю и глобально возрастающий.
public virtual int runtimeID()
setMeta(string)
Устанавливает метаданные. Эта операция перезапишет предыдущие настройки или данные, возвращенные сервером.
public virtual void setMeta(string data)
Параметры
data
setName(string)
Устанавливает имя цели. Эта операция перезапишет предыдущие настройки или данные, возвращенные сервером.
public virtual void setName(string name)
Параметры
name
uid()
Получает UID цели. UID ImageTarget используется в алгоритме облачного распознавания. При отсутствии подключения к облачному распознаванию вы можете установить этот UID в JSON-конфигурации и использовать его в своем коде как альтернативный способ различения целей.
public virtual string uid()